💥 The AI Boom Isn’t Neutral — It’s an Earthquake of Power Shifts

AI was supposed to make things easier, smarter, fairer.
Instead, it’s quietly rewriting who gets to win—and who gets ignored.

For every promise of productivity, there’s a layoff.
For every AI tool that empowers a creator, there’s a platform scraping their work without consent.
And for every dollar saved by automation, there’s a worker who’s become invisible.

We’re told that AI is just a tool. But who’s holding it—and how they use it—is what determines its ethics.
And right now? It’s being wielded by those chasing profit, not principles.

🧠 Power Isn’t Spreading — It’s Concentrating

Let’s be clear: AI is not democratizing power. It’s concentrating it.
At least for now.

Corporations building AI systems have insider access, talent monopolies, and an early lead that’s impossible to match for the average individual.
Yes, tools like ChatGPT or Midjourney may feel empowering for a creator or solopreneur — but that power is borrowed, and it's paid for monthly.

The AI giants are not just offering tools.
They’re shaping the future of work, truth, and trust — on their terms.

Inside companies, AI isn’t a collaborative decision.
It's a boardroom directive, pushed top-down, without transparency.

And governments? They're five steps behind, fumbling with frameworks while job functions vanish overnight.

⚖️ Invisible People, Biased Systems

You've probably heard it: “AI doesn’t discriminate. It’s just math.”

That’s not just false — it’s dangerous.

  • Hiring decisions are now made by AI filters scanning resumes for keywords. You might be brilliant. But if you don’t say the right words, you’re out.

  • Layoffs are being justified by "AI performance analytics" with no human intervention. That’s not optimization. That’s outsourced cruelty.

  • A friend of my wife lost her job after AI-driven appraisal data flagged her as “non-critical.” No conversation. No context. Just cut.

I was fired last year too — not by a manager, but by an algorithm evaluating “project viability.”

AI makes fast decisions. But fast doesn’t mean fair.

💰 The Creator's Dilemma: Pay Up or Be Mined

As a solo builder, I’m trying to ride this AI wave with honesty. But I see the trap too clearly:

  • If you can’t build AI, you’ll have to pay for it.

  • If you create content, your work may already be part of someone else’s training dataset.

  • If you write, design, code, speak, or think online — you’re the product.

This isn’t about collaboration. It’s extraction dressed up as empowerment.

And unless we name that openly, the illusion will continue.

🔍 What’s Not Being Talked About

No one’s asking this, but I will:
How much do companies really know about their employees that they’re not saying?

With AI analytics tracking performance, keystrokes, productivity scores, client impact, sentiment scores, internal data — decisions are being made months before they’re announced.

AI doesn’t just see your work. It’s seeing you, scoring you, and deciding if you’re “worth keeping.”

That’s not just unethical. That’s inhuman.
